中间件上的路由错误

Ped*_*dro 2 laravel laravel-5.2

你好我得到一个错误"参数2传递给Illuminate\Routing\Router :: group()必须是一个Closure的实例",我相信我做得很好,但仍然得到这个错误,我做错了什么?我的laravel版本是5.2

代码路由:

Route::group(['middleware' => ['auth', 'admin'], function() {
        Route::get('admin/dashboard', 'PageController@dashboard');

other routes...
}]);
Run Code Online (Sandbox Code Playgroud)

Dev*_*evK 6

移动支架,一切都很好.当它被认为是第二个参数时,你传递了数组中的闭包.

Route::group(['middleware' => ['auth', 'admin']], function() {
        Route::get('admin/dashboard', 'PageController@dashboard');

other routes...
});
Run Code Online (Sandbox Code Playgroud)